    Grow with SAP and Accelerated Adoption to S/4HANA ERP 

    Jack WilsonBy Jack WilsonApril 22, 20244 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Reddit WhatsApp Email

    We explore here why Grow with SAP exists and how it helps firms to transition to SAP’s flagship ERP platforms to attain more control and efficiency.

    Introduction:

    Grow with SAP is not a product rather is a combination of already implemented services in a package to speed up the digital transformation of a midsize business onto the S/4HANA Cloud public edition. This transformation package enables smaller to mid sized businesses that already have implemented an ERP platform but the growing business needs a expandable solution.

    To help with their huge transformation, this ready-to-run cloud platform features preconfigured best practices from SAP, and Business Technology Platform (BTP) integration all powered with embedded AI/automation tools to help firms transition to their new ERP platform more securely and swiftly. 

    In short, this software-as-a-service (SaaS) is designed to educate firms to adapt to the latest technologies and business techniques while making their digital transformation to SAP’s latest ERP platform. It remains continuously updated with the latest and most significant business practices. Below are the significant outcomes when firms select this implementation plan:

    1. Safe Digital Transformation:

    A business going to transition from its ongoing operations to something new is always challenging as it poses many hidden risks that one may not be prepared for. Grow with SAP helps businesses develop a digital strategy for the comprehensive implementation and optimizing SAP solutions which use cryptographic algorithms in their encryption methods to protect data during transit. Moreover, SAP uses access control mechanisms along with Data Masking and Redaction to make sure that the transition is done with the highest level of protected confidentiality. 

    2. Easy Scalability: 

    The public edition of SAP S/4HANA Cloud linked with this implementation plan is scalable and easily adaptable to your evolving business needs without introducing additional complexity. It operates based on industry best practices and offers preconfigured, ready-to-use procedures that promote continuous innovation and help you develop your business more quickly.

    3. Community Engagement

    Over the years, SAP has managed to develop a rich community of platform users, business staff, experts, and partners who are known to connect, effectively collaborate, and share experiences and best practices. This helps firms to get peer-to-peer support and stay updated with the industry’s trends when moving to the SAP S/4HANA Cloud ERP platform. 

    4. Better Decision-Making

    Powered with the S/4HANA cloud platform, businesses can extract deeper and more valuable insights from their data. This gives them leverage to use these insights to better plan and make decisions in the right direction in the ever-evolving dynamics of their respective market. 

    These decisions are directly extracted from identifying trends and forecasting the future opportunities that this business can seize by making appropriate modifications to its business plans. In essence, it helps businesses secure and grow their presence by making correct choices.

    5. Preconfigured Practices: 

    This implementation plan uses the best practices from SAP’s own experience over the years and is modified with the current market trends. All these plans are already set up in the package and ready to be utilized when the transformation is done. This facilitates the process of setting up a fully functional resource planning system on a public cloud with updated business guidance from SAP. 

    Other than these significant features, Grow with SAP is also a great option for those who are not looking for an over-complicated starting point when entering a resource planning ecosystem. It gives them uncomplicated access to the benefits offered by the cloud resource planning world and provides them with application scenarios that are crucial for scaling. Firms that are looking for custom processes should opt for Rise with SAP, another implementation offering from the company. 

    Wrapping Up:

    Grow with SAP combines acceleration services for mid-sized firms that are already running on an entERPrise resource planning platform and need to scale their business. It is a pathway to the world’s leading cloud ERP solution that is ready to use and comes with a predictable, expedited setup powered with AI and backed by a community that SAP has been able to foster for decades. The transfer of business data in the highest security standards and scalable cloud platforms makes it a great transition tool for mid-sized firms.
